Augusta, GA vs Walla Walla, WA
Cost of Living Comparison
Augusta, GA is more affordable by 6.6 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Augusta, GA | Walla Walla, WA |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 91.9 | 98.5 | -6.6 |
| Housing | 70.6 | 86.6 | -16.0 |
| Goods | 96.3 | 105.0 | -8.7 |
| Utilities | 89.5 | 94.3 | -4.8 |
| Other Services | 98.5 | 99.5 | -0.9 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Augusta, GA | Walla Walla, WA |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$62,941 | $66,635 |
| Median Home Value | $186,700 | $331,600 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,016 | $1,044 |
| Per Capita Income | $33,509 | $34,476 |
